如何监控和诊断阿里云SQL数据库的性能问题?

在使用阿里云SQL数据库时,确保其高效运行对于任何企业或开发者来说都是至关重要的。性能问题可能会导致响应时间变慢、资源利用率低以及用户体验下降等问题。了解如何监控和诊断这些性能问题是提高系统稳定性和效率的关键。

如何监控和诊断阿里云SQL数据库的性能问题?

一、设置有效的监控机制

1. 使用内置工具:阿里云提供了多种内置工具来帮助用户监控SQL数据库的状态。例如,通过云监控服务,可以实时查看CPU使用率、内存消耗、磁盘I/O等关键指标。还可以配置告警规则,在某些指标超过预设阈值时自动发送通知。

2. 第三方集成:除了官方提供的工具外,也可以考虑将其他第三方监控软件与阿里云平台进行集成。这不仅可以提供更多维度的数据分析,而且有助于发现潜在的问题并提前采取措施。

二、识别常见的性能瓶颈

1. 查询优化:不合理的SQL查询往往是造成性能瓶颈的主要原因之一。建议定期审查应用程序中的查询语句,避免不必要的全表扫描操作,并尽量利用索引加速检索过程。注意对复杂查询进行拆分处理以减少单次执行所需的时间。

2. 连接管理:过多的并发连接也会给数据库带来压力。应合理规划应用程序与数据库之间的连接池大小,并确保每个会话结束后及时释放资源。还需关注长事务占用情况,防止长时间未提交的事务阻塞其他进程。

三、深入分析与故障排除

1. 日志审查:当遇到难以定位的问题时,可以通过查阅日志文件获取更多信息。阿里云SQL数据库支持记录详细的错误日志和慢查询日志,从中可以找到异常发生的线索。结合时间戳信息,还能追溯到具体的操作或事件。

2. 专业支持:如果经过初步排查仍然无法解决问题,不妨寻求专业的技术支持。阿里云拥有经验丰富的工程师团队,他们可以根据具体情况提供针对性的解决方案。在社区论坛中分享遇到的问题也可能获得他人的宝贵意见。

四、预防性维护策略

1. 定期备份:为了防止数据丢失或损坏影响业务连续性,必须建立完善的备份制度。根据实际需求选择增量备份或全量备份方式,并定期验证恢复流程的有效性。

2. 升级硬件/软件:随着业务规模不断扩大,现有硬件设备可能逐渐无法满足日益增长的需求。此时应及时评估是否需要升级服务器配置或者更换更先进的存储介质。与此保持操作系统及数据库管理系统处于最新版本同样重要,因为新版本通常包含性能改进和安全补丁。

监控和诊断阿里云SQL数据库的性能问题是一项持续性的任务,它涉及到多个方面的考量和技术手段的应用。通过上述方法,相信可以帮助您更好地管理和优化数据库环境,从而为用户提供更加流畅的服务体验。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/154006.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月22日 下午12:35
下一篇 2025年1月22日 下午12:35

相关推荐

  • 如何解决MySQL中的慢查询问题?

    MySQL作为最受欢迎的关系型数据库之一,被广泛应用于各种Web应用程序和企业级应用中。在高并发访问或者数据量较大的情况下,MySQL的查询速度可能会变慢。本文将详细介绍一些常见的优化方法,帮助你解决MySQL中的慢查询问题。 一、使用索引 1. 理解索引的作用:索引是提高SQL查询性能的关键因素。它可以帮助MySQL快速定位到符合条件的数据行,而无需扫描整…

    2025年1月22日
    600
  • SQL Server日志文件过大,怎样进行有效管理?

    SQL Server日志文件是数据库管理系统(DBMS)中的重要组成部分,它记录了所有事务操作的信息。随着业务的增长和数据量的增加,日志文件可能会变得异常庞大,从而占用大量磁盘空间并影响性能。为了确保系统的稳定性和高效运行,对过大的日志文件进行有效的管理至关重要。 1. 了解日志文件的作用 在深入探讨如何管理过大的日志文件之前,我们首先需要了解其作用。SQL…

    2025年1月20日
    800
  • 如何优化宝塔面板中的MySQL数据库性能?

    在现代的Web应用开发中,MySQL作为最常用的开源关系型数据库之一,其性能直接决定了网站的响应速度和用户体验。而宝塔面板作为一个强大的服务器管理工具,为管理员提供了便捷的MySQL配置和优化途径。本文将详细介绍如何通过宝塔面板来优化MySQL数据库性能。 1. 更新与版本控制 确保你正在使用的MySQL版本是最新的稳定版本。新版本通常会包含性能改进、安全修…

    2025年1月21日
    600
  • 网络不稳定导致买空间网数据库连接失败,如何解决?

    在使用买空间网(假设为一个提供云服务或托管服务的平台)时,偶尔会遇到由于网络不稳定而导致的数据库连接失败问题。这种情况不仅会影响用户体验,还可能导致业务中断。本文将探讨如何解决这一问题,并提供一些实用的建议。 1. 检查本地网络环境 确保你的本地网络环境稳定。可以通过以下几种方式来检查: – 使用ping命令测试与目标服务器之间的延迟和丢包率。如…

    2025年1月23日
    600
  • phpMyAdmin中不同排序规则对数据库性能有何影响?

    在数据库管理系统中,性能优化是确保应用程序高效运行的关键因素之一。phpMyAdmin作为一个流行的MySQL数据库管理工具,为用户提供了直观的界面来执行各种操作,包括创建、编辑和查询数据库。其中一个重要的功能就是对数据进行排序。不同的排序规则可能会对数据库性能产生显著影响。本文将探讨phpMyAdmin中不同排序规则对数据库性能的影响,并提供一些建议以优化…

    2025年1月19日
    800

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部